2017-08-23 The History of Bees] is reminiscent of the 1998 art film The Red Violin, in that it weaves together three fairly disparate stories spread across the better part of two and a half centuries. At the outset, the connections between the three are opaque, but Lunde’s compelling narrative draws the reader in.

1975) is the most successful Norwegian author of her generation. Her books are translated into 40 languages and has sold more than 2,5 million copies. Lunde’s debut novel The History of Bees (2015) was an instant hit and sold to several territories before Norwegian publication. 2017-09-15 Maja Lunde The History of Bees William is a depressed biologist and seed merchant in England 1852. Now he sets out to build a wholly new type of beehive, which will give him and his children honour and fame.
